Dance Rules & Regulations
-
1. Students are expected to attend all classes, listen to their teacher, and treat everyone with respect.
-
2. No gum, food, or drinks (will the exception of bottled water) are allowed in the dance room.
-
3. No street shoes are to be worn in the dance room, all dance shoes may not be worn outside.
-
4. Proper attire must be worn to class. No jeans, skirts, or overly restrictive clothing.
-
5. Ballet attire: leotard, tights, ballet shoes, and hair in a bun.
-
6. Jazz, tap, and hip hop attire: Leggings or jazz pants, leotards, tighter fitting tank top or t-shirt.
